How much do procurement financial anal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for procurement financial analyst in Texas is $83,632.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$56,400.00 and $108,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a procurement financial analyst?

To thrive as a Procurement Financial Analyst, a strong background in finance, accounting, data analysis, and supply chain management, often supported by a bachelor's degree in a related field, is essential. Familiarity with ERP systems like SAP or Oracle, advanced Excel skills, and certifications such as Certified Purchasing Professional (CPP) or Certified Public Accountant (CPA) are often required. Anal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for interpreting data and collaborating with stakeholders. These skills ensure accurate financial analysis, optimized procurement processes, and informed decision-making that drive organizational value.

What is the difference between Procurement Financial Analyst vs Purchasing Analyst?

AspectProcurement Financial AnalystPurchasing Analyst
CredentialsBachelor's in Finance, Accounting, or Business; often CPA or CFABachelor's in Business, Supply Chain, or related field
Work EnvironmentFinance departments, procurement teams, corporate officesProcurement or purchasing departments, supply chain offices
Employer & IndustryCorporations, government agencies, large organizationsRetail, manufacturing, logistics companies
Common Search & ComparisonFocuses on financial analysis within procurementFocuses on purchasing activities and supplier management

The Procurement Financial Analyst primarily handles financial analysis related to procurement activities, ensuring cost efficiency and budget compliance. In contrast, a Purchasing Analyst focuses on the day-to-day purchasing operations and supplier negotiations. Both roles are essential in procurement but differ in their focus—financial oversight versus procurement execution.

How does a procurement financial analyst typically collaborate with other departments within an organization?

Procurement Financial Analysts work closely with procurement teams, finance departments, and business unit leaders to ensure purchasing decisions align with organizational budgets and goals. They often support contract negotiations, provide financial analysis for sourcing decisions, and help track cost-saving initiatives. Regular interaction with suppliers and internal stakeholders is common, requiring strong communication and analytical skills. This cross-functional collaboration is essential for optimizing procurement processes and achieving financial targets.

What is a procurement financial analyst?

A Procurement Financial Analyst is a professional who evaluates and manages the financial aspects of an organization's procurement activities. They analyze costs, budgets, and supplier contracts to ensure that purchasing decisions align with the company's financial goals. Their role often involves forecasting expenditures, identifying cost-saving opportunities, and providing financial insights to support procurement strategies. By doing so, they help ensure that the organization gets the best value for its spending while maintaining compliance with financial policies.

About the job:
Job Summary
Seeking a proactive detail-oriented, but able to "see the broader picture" Financial Analyst to spearhead expense management, financial analysis, and strategic reporting. The ideal candidate will be responsible for transforming raw, unstructured data into actionable insights, utilizing advanced Excel/Google Sheets techniques, AI-driven automation, and visualization tools. You will identify cost-saving opportunities and communicate complex financial narratives through high-impact dashboards and executive-level presentations. You must be able to use broadly available AI tools to make your work highly effective and leverage them to focus on deeper, more insight generating analysis
Key Responsibilities
Expense Analysis & Data Management
  • Expense Reporting & Categorization: Execute comprehensive expense analysis by ingesting and cleaning raw financial data, transforming it into structured, category-ready table formats (tracking parameters such as price, volume, services, and user metrics).
  • Cost Optimization: Identify and drive measurable cost savings through deep-dive labor efficiency analysis, vendor spend optimization, and trend identification.
  • Data Integrity: Automate manual reporting processes to reduce turn-around time and improve data integrity, ensuring accurate tracking of revenue and expense variances against budgets.
  • Advanced Modeling: Conduct thorough financial analysis, including variance and trend analysis, utilizing complex formulas and macros in Excel/Google Sheets to support business decisions.

Dashboarding & Presentation
  • Dashboard Development: Design and maintain interactive, KPI-focused dashboards in Tableau and/or Power BI to provide senior leadership with clear visibility into P&L performance, expense vs. budget comparisons, and operational metrics.
  • AI-Enhanced Reporting: Leverage AI tools and Large Language Models (LLMs) to automate data summarization, draft narrative reports, and accelerate the creation of complex slide decks and presentations.
  • Executive Presentations: Develop and present executive-ready PowerPoint decks that synthesize data visualizations into clear, strategic narratives for management, highlighting key trends and actionable insights.

Operational & Strategic Partnership
  • Cross-Functional Collaboration: Partner with Procurement, Finance, Legal, and other business lines to translate operational activities into financial plans and provide recommendations for strategic decision-making.
  • Forecasting & Budgeting: Assist in the ongoing budget and forecast process, tracking variance drivers and ensuring alignment between financial plans and operational goals.

Qualifications
  • Experience: Minimum of 3 years of experience in financial analysis, budgeting, forecasting, and expense management in the financial industry or management consulting.
  • Data Visualization: Proven ability to build dashboards in Tableau or Power BI; proficiency in SQL for data mining and extraction is highly preferred.
  • Technical Proficiency: Expert-level proficiency in Microsoft Excel/Google Sheets (complex formulas, macros, and pivot tables) and PowerPoint.
  • AI/Tooling: Experience or strong aptitude for using AI tools (ChatGPT, Gemini etc.) to streamline financial reporting, data categorization, and presentation design.
  • Education: Bachelor's degree in Finance or Business (MBA preferred).

Competencies: Exceptional problem-solving and analytical skills with the ability to communicate complex financial concepts to non-financial stakeholders. Combines sharp attention to detail with strong critical thinking to produce reliable deliverables. Consistently applies a reasonability check to all data, proactively escalating unintuitive results or potential discrepancies for further review prior to submission.
